City Constructs Exhibition

This virtual exhibition is of cityscapes first seen in solo shows over the past decade, combined with work which is more recent. For the first time these images are hung together, creating a new rhythm and dialogue. Each individual work is constructed from photos collected over years of travelling. Although the completed images themselves are at the most only ten years old, they already seem to represent a very different idea of the city from the one we are now experiencing. In this retrospective we see city landscapes as they once were, of the crowd as it funnels and splays through city streets and plazas. The exhibition thus becomes not only about space, but also times of change.
